Dharmakaya (chos sku).

  • The first of the Three Kayas, which is devoid of constructs, and space-like as this nature of all things. The basic and all-pervasive nature of all phenomena. Dharmakaya also is designated as the 'body' of enlightened qualities. Dharmakaya should be understood individually according to ground, path and fruition. [RY]

The kayas: Various aspects or states of buddhahood. One recognizes two, three, four, or five kayas.
